The U.S.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it ordered the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to review the potential harm a toxic new fungicide poses to endangered species by June 22, 2023. The Center for Biological Diversity and the Center for Food Safety had appealed the EPA’s 2020 approval of the fungicide inpyrfluxam for some of the most widely grown U.S. crops. Plaintiffs presented evidence that the pesticide is “very highly toxic” to fish, including endangered salmon and steelhead, and poses substantial risks to large birds, including whooping cranes.
